summaryrefslogtreecommitdiff
path: root/examples/echo_client_tulip.py
diff options
context:
space:
mode:
Diffstat (limited to 'examples/echo_client_tulip.py')
-rw-r--r--examples/echo_client_tulip.py7
1 files changed, 4 insertions, 3 deletions
diff --git a/examples/echo_client_tulip.py b/examples/echo_client_tulip.py
index 88124ef..0a60926 100644
--- a/examples/echo_client_tulip.py
+++ b/examples/echo_client_tulip.py
@@ -1,15 +1,16 @@
-import asyncio
+import trollius as asyncio
+from trollius import From
END = b'Bye-bye!\n'
@asyncio.coroutine
def echo_client():
- reader, writer = yield from asyncio.open_connection('localhost', 8000)
+ reader, writer = yield From(asyncio.open_connection('localhost', 8000))
writer.write(b'Hello, world\n')
writer.write(b'What a fine day it is.\n')
writer.write(END)
while True:
- line = yield from reader.readline()
+ line = yield From(reader.readline())
print('received:', line)
if line == END or not line:
break